WebCat is the online catalog for the Mark & Helen Osterlin Library. Materials on these topics can be located by doing a subject search using the terms botany or horticulture, or alternate headings such as agriculture, plant physiology, the names of specific plants, etc. An alternative method of locating is browsing the library shelves in the areas of QK (botany) and SB (horticulture).
